How does the National Park Service keep the presidents looking pristine? In this episode of Podcasts with Park Rangers we discuss Mount Rushmore preservation efforts with the Assistant Cheif of Interpretation, Blaine Kortemeyer. We learn about his unique role on the Rope Access team — a unique group of Rangers who see eye to eye with the presidents for the sake of maintenance.
